About Syngenta Flowers

Syngenta Flowers is one of the largest wholesale breeders of flowers in the world – developing and producing flower seeds and cuttings for growers internationally. Syngenta Flowers is dedicated to the breeding of innovative flower varieties that offer outstanding performance in the professional greenhouse, at retail, in the landscape, and in the home garden. In addition to best-in-class genetics, we support industry professionals with outstanding customer service, in-depth cultural information, flexible and exciting marketing programs, and a deep understanding of plants from many points of view.
